1 - Allow complete disabling of internal processing (noise reduction and sharpness) with internal codecs (0 isn’t truly 0 in the S5 & S5II/X). It’s a stupid limitation, forcing the camera to use processing power that we don’t even want.. 🤦🏻‍♂️ 2 - OLPF in all video centric models. We don’t care about ridiculously sharp images, especially when moiré creeps in and ruin everything! 3 - Add a Shutter Angle ONLY lock option in the Operation Lock menu. I literaly have to put a piece of black gaffer tape on the dial to prevent accident that would ruin the footage.. 4 - Truly fix the HDMI lag 5 - Stop downconverting 33x LUTs into shitty 17x for monitoring V-Log. When using RealTimeLUT, the monitoring is in full 33x, so it makes no sense that the camera wouldn’t be able to do it when shooting in V-Log.. it’s full of banding artifacts/macro-blocking, especially in underexposed areas. In 2024, that’s innacceptable. 6 - Reduce Rolling Shutter below 16 ms 🙏🏻 7 - Redesign connectivity so the HDMI cable will allow us to tilt the screen. PDAF is excellent and very useful, but since we can’t control it from an external monitor, it sucks that we can’t fully articulate the screen. Also, the S1H screen design would be better. 8 - There’s a weird glitch on my S5IIX : When I fire up the camera (or swap batteries), my custom presets (V-Log + monitoring LUT) load with a 2nd instance of the LUT baked into the footage. If I start recording, it’s like i’m using RealTimeLUT (one instance of the LUT will be baked into the file). It’s like i’m both using V-Log + LUT monitoring & RealTimeLUT at the same time.. which is not even possible. The only way to make this go away is to either rotate the right dial a few notches and come back on my custom preset (then, the 2nd LUT disappear and everything is back to normal). Freaking annoying!
